Collapse the two proxy shapes (path_prefix + host) to a single checkbox: a service is either port-only, or exposed at <service-name>.<gateway.domain>. Path routes and their prefix-stripping foot-guns are gone; the subdomain is always the service name (rename the service to change it). - Schema: CaddySpec is just `enable` (presence = expose). service_proxy_targets returns (expose, port, base_url); Deployment carries `subdomain` (was proxy_path/proxy_host). Registry/deploy/mesh/CLI updated in lockstep. - Generator: compute_routes emits one host route per exposed service/frontend (address = name). acme mode = one *.<domain> site with a reverse_proxy matcher per service + a file_server matcher per frontend; the :<port> site redirects to the dashboard. off mode = a HTTP control plane on :<port> (dashboard at / + /api → castle-api); other services are port-only. - Dashboard/API: castle-app and castle-api are ordinary subdomains. The dashboard derives the API base at runtime (castle-api.<domain> on a subdomain, else /api) and calls it cross-origin — castle-api already allows CORS *. Frontends build with VITE_BASE=/ (served at their subdomain root). - CLI: `service create` drops --path/--host; --no-proxy makes it port-only. - Docs/tests reworked for the model; docs use generic placeholders only (no personal host/domain/IP details).
